Home > Jsp Error > Jsp Error Page Portlet

Jsp Error Page Portlet

share|improve this answer answered Feb 4 '13 at 13:43 ssloan 9233820 add a comment| Your Answer draft saved draft discarded Sign up or log in Sign up using Google Sign The FacesPortlet could be extended to handle the unexpected exception and forward to custom error page. Can someone help me with that? Refer to tracing instructions for the TSM Administration Center to turn on the trace and look for any exceptions in the trace. this contact form

If the problem persists, please contact the portal administrator. Riaan Minne IBM South Africa Log in to reply. dispatch("/ErrorMessage.jsp"); }catch(Exception er){System.out.println("error message slash");er.printStackTrace();} %> Points to consider here The errors.jsp should be a plain html without JSF view. If not, then there lies the source of your problems.

Another cause might be a compile error of the Java Server Page (JSP) page which should have not happened unless the page has been modified. The exception is thrown in the action phase, before the first line of the handling method is called (as I can't find my debug output in the log). In combination with Portlet, this could be bit tricky. This could be overcome by injecting a forward page before error Page and modifying the web.xml and jsp to point to new forward page // web.xml java.lang.Throwable /error/errorForward.jsp //

But I could only see the old "portlet XYZ is temporarily unavailable."I am wondering if I am missing anything here. No error intermediate forward page Doesn't require any change in jsp/jsf 's or in web.xml. Second, double-check your view resolver(s), because what you pass to the bean as property values, "defError", "notAuthorized" and "notAvailable", are logical names that Spring will translate into actual concrete views only If the error is ignored then it will be treated by the portal policy.

When the page is invoked, a set of request attributes are passed. FacesPortlet which extends GenericPortlet class is controller class for all JSF-JSR168 Portlet. If you think it's not spring related, which component would you think of instead? How do you all handle these situations? /Chr Log in to reply.

There has been an application error! Key points which tilt decision in this favour are Changes are very controlled as exception handling happens in one place. When the page is invoked it will be passed a set of request attributes. Referee did not fully understand accepted paper How exactly std::string_view is faster than const std::string&?

First, it doesn't forward to the error page. Reason: new stuff Tags: None Enrico Pizzi Senior Member Join Date: Jul 2010 Posts: 713 #2 Sep 6th, 2010, 02:03 AM And how does all this concern Spring in any way? Related 0How to Hide/view the portlets in liferay Portal?1How to get url request parameter from inside LIferay/IceFaces/JSF portlet backing bean4Portlet Navigation in Liferay1Can't get jQuery to work with Icefaces + Liferay1Order Compute the Eulerian number The determinant of the matrix Spaced-out numbers Can I stop this homebrewed Lucky Coin ability from being exploited?

Or if there is a better approach to achieve the same, would welcome that too.TIA,Peter Sign in to vote. weblink up vote 1 down vote favorite Here is one of the use-case as to what I want to do: A User clicks on a blog-link or directly pastes the blog-link in You can display a message in this case using the tag. Topic Forum Directory >‎ WebSphere >‎ Forum: WebSphere Portal >‎ Topic: JSF portlet (jsr 168) error handling - why oh why... 5 replies Latest Post - ‏2006-05-12T10:41:13Z by SystemAdmin Display:ConversationsBy Date

This caused an exception when the page is rendered. Four tabs will appear on the left-hand side of the page. Any exception occurring out of the call results in portletException = true. navigate here If it fails, we set the view using the standard ViewResolver we normally use, which in our case is the JspViewResolver (I think this is the name). –CodeChimp Feb 1 '13

I keep getting a PortletException (Assertion Failed) error after error.jsp:init. This approach should only be evaluated if a strong business case exists. Rather, catch these exception and throw more customized error message like "Dear User, You won't have access to Annual Report.xls.

How to use color ramp with torus Conditional summation How to create a company culture that cares about information security?

SystemAdmin 110000D4XK ‏2006-05-10T14:20:17Z You can display a message in this case using the tag. more hot questions question feed lang-java about us tour help blog chat data legal privacy policy work here advertising info mobile contact us feedback Technology Life / Arts Culture / Recreation The following table represents possible portal-policy properties: Table 9.1. Property NameDescriptionPossible Valuescontrol.portal.access_deniedwhen access is deniedignore and jspcontrol.portal.unavailablewhen a resource is unavailableignore and jspcontrol.portal.not_foundwhen a resource is not foundignore and jspcontrol.portal.internal_errorwhen an unexpected error Click the Admin tab on the top right-hand of the welcome page.

How to deal with a coworker who is making fun of my work? "the Salsa20 core preserves diagonal shifts" Is it legal to bring board games (made of wood) to Australia? There are a number of approaches which could be followed for the same a) General exception handling for servlet/jsp based applications b) Extending FacePortlet c) Writing custom lifecycle and NavigationHandler. For further reading refer to http://www.jroller.com/mert/entry/handling_errors_with_an_errror by mert This approach cannot be deployed in the Portal environment as the FacesServlet is not exposed. his comment is here asked 3 years ago viewed 462 times active 3 years ago Blog Stack Overflow Podcast #91 - Can You Stump Nick Craver?

Has anybody has any luck using a Faces error page and if so can you get to the exception in the backing beans so you can log it and present as Related 5679How to redirect to another page in jQuery?5How to customize which portlets to show in “Add more portlets” menu0Liferay Page redirection0How to automatically redirect to home page after session-timeout0How to Not the answer you're looking for? If the control policy ignores the error then the next policy will handle the error at this turn.

Platform Resources Services Company Sign In Platform Resources Services Company Marketplace Community Developer Network Deutsch English Español Français Italiano Português 中文 日本語 Search Forums Home » Liferay Portal » English » Regards jsf portlet liferay icefaces share|improve this question edited Oct 31 '11 at 23:57 user212218 asked Feb 8 '10 at 16:35 Luis Gervaso 113 add a comment| 2 Answers 2 active More... Then add your custom logic to the overridden JSP.

If there is a connection problem to the TSM server, the bean which holds all the initial values for the fields on this page may not have been initialized properly. Here's a simple example: Log in to reply. Exceptions in compiled error.jsp (instead of showing the error page) Page Title Module Move Remove Collapse X Conversation Detail Module Collapse Posts Latest Activity Search Forums Page of 1 Filter Time Don't forget to register the new FacesPortlet in Portlet.xml.

If the control policy provides a new response, the next policy is not invoked, since the new response is not an error. I need to implement this in production server(Enterprise Edition of Liferay).At the time of using portal if the Database goes down then if we click on any tab, it displays blank Replacing a pattern with a string 4 dogs have been born in the same week. Subview could be used; unfortunately the action methods of the managed beans cannot be invoked from Subview.